UK producer and DJ Chewna returns with Wonky Walk, his debut on Perfect Havoc – a slick, understated house track that drifts between deep, melodic, and tech territory.
Loose percussion, brass-led synths, and snappy vocal chops give it an easy swing and character that recall the cool restraint of Cola, but with a warmth and groove that’s distinctly Chewna’s own.
Fresh from the success of Infinity, which climbed to #8 on the Beatport charts earlier this year, Wonky Walk finds him in confident form. It’s a track that balances musicality and subtle tension, rooted in Chewna’s appreciation for movement, connection, and groove-led storytelling.
Chewna’s sound blends classic house depth with crisp modern production, creating music that feels lived-in yet forward-looking. Wonky Walk continues that thread: soulful, refined, and full of quiet detail, a sign of an artist shaping a sound that’s only becoming more distinctive.
